Инсталирайте персонализирани ROM и GSI на устройства Samsung Galaxy без TWRP

XDA Junior Member kkoo демонстрира иновативен начин за флаш персонализирани ROM и GSI на устройства Samsung Galaxy без използване на TWRP. Прочетете, за да научите повече!

Samsung доставя своите смартфони и таблети с марката "Galaxy" силно модифицирани версии на софтуер за Android, последното поколение на които е известно като Един потребителски интерфейс. Освен всички разлики, свързани с потребителския интерфейс/UX спрямо стандартния Android, има една специфична функция, която прави устройствата с Android на Samsung много уникални в сравнение с устройствата на други производители. Корейският OEM замества обикновения механизъм Fastboot със собствен протокол в своите продукти. Вътрешно кръстен на герои от скандинавската митология, частта от код, изпълнявана на устройството, е известен като "Loke", докато компонентът от отдалечената страна (обикновено компютър) се нарича "Odin".

Как да изтеглите фърмуера на Odin, за да понижите, надстроите или възстановите вашия Samsung Galaxy

Липсата на интерфейс, съвместим с Fastboot, може да звучи като огромна пречка за сцената на модифициране, но общността на разработчиците на резервни части винаги е успявала да се докопа до

изтече Двоични файлове на Один, за да свършите нещата. Самият персонализиран протокол беше обратно проектиран отдавна, което доведе до междуплатформен мигащ инструмент с отворен код, наречен Хаймдал. Човек може да компилира Heimdall от изходния код или просто да вземе пачирана версия на Odin, за да root на своите устройства Samsung Galaxy, инсталирайте персонализирано възстановяване като TWRP и изпълнете много други мигащи задачи.

След като инсталирате TWRP, можете лесно заменете версията на Android на Samsung с персонализиран Android ROM като LineageOS. Дори ако няма налични персонализирани ROM за вашия модел Samsung, можете технически инсталирайте Generic System Image (GSI), при условие че устройството е съвместимо с Project Treble и се предлага с отключващ буутлоудър. Въпреки това пренасянето на TWRP към скорошни устройства на Samsung, работещи с Android 10/One UI 2, веднага (напр. Galaxy S20 серия) е a сложна задача. Липсата на стабилно персонализирано възстановяване директно възпрепятства възможността за инсталиране на персонализирани ROM/GSI на такива модели.

Младши член на XDA kkoo сега излезе с умна идея да заобиколи повечето от тези препятствия. Предвид факта, че официалният фърмуерен пакет на Samsung не е нищо друго освен колекция от LZ4 компресирани архиви, подобно пакетиран персонализиран ROM (или GSI) може да бъде флашнат с помощта на Odin. The Проверено зареждане функцията на целевото устройство трябва да бъде деактивирана предварително, което може да се постигне чрез инсталиране на a null vbmeta изображение, предоставено от Google.

Всички инструкции, които трябва да следвате, са публикувани в нишката на форума, свързана по-долу. Процесът, описан от XDA Junior Member kkoo изисква изпълнение на някои скриптове от командния ред от вашия компютър, работещ под Windows. Инструкциите за мигане и конфигуриране на GSI също са свързани в същата публикация във форума.

Използване на Odin за инсталиране на персонализиран ROM/GSI на устройство Samsung Galaxy без TWRP